Nada Kuroiwa Suisenkyo, located in the southern part of Awaji Island, is one of Japan's leading scenic spots where about 5 million wild narcissuses bloom on steep slopes. In winter from January to February each year, the entire area is covered with the lovely white flowers of narcissuses, and a sweet, gentle scent wafts around. Against the backdrop of the blue and calm Kii Channel, the contrast of narcissuses blooming powerfully in the cold winter air is breathtakingly beautiful. Climbing up the walkway, a panoramic superb view where the sea and flowers meld together spreads out, making it a popular healing spot where you can quietly converse with nature while feeling the winter atmosphere of Japan.
